The Railway Training Institute (RTI) is seeking to recruit qualified and experienced individuals to serve as Part-Time Lecturers in the fields of Information Communication Technology (ICT) and Library Science. This recruitment is intended to populate the Institute's database of resource persons. Successful candidates will be engaged on a need basis to provide high-quality technical training and mentorship to students within the TVET framework.
Responsibilities
Deliver lectures and practical instructions in either ICT or Library Science subjects.
Prepare comprehensive course materials, lesson plans, and teaching aids.
Administer continuous assessment tests and final examinations to evaluate student performance.
Monitor student progress, provide feedback, and offer academic guidance/mentorship.
Ensure all training activities comply with TVET and institutional standards.
Maintain accurate records of student attendance and grades.
Mandatory Requirements
Academic Background: A Bachelor’s Degree in the relevant field (ICT or Library Science) from a recognized university.
Professional Training: A Degree in Education, a Postgraduate Diploma in Education (PGDE), or a Diploma in Technical Education / Instructors’ Training Course.
Professional Status: Registration and/or membership with a relevant professional body.
Accreditation: Must possess valid TVET accreditation.
Experience: A minimum of four (4) years’ teaching or relevant industry experience at a comparable level.
